The World Health Organization (WHO) has defined stress as the leading cause of illness worldwide. The skin, the largest organ of the human body, is the most exposed to its effects: it shows signs of premature aging, especially on the face, with wrinkles, folds and volumetric and morpho-structural alterations that compromise its beauty, in men and women of all ages.
The mechanisms by which light interacts with the body are now well known and codified: absorbed photons accelerate electron transfer in the mitochondrial respiratory chain and stimulate, through cytochrome c oxidase (the main mitochondrial photoacceptor), the production of small amounts of reactive oxygen species (ROS). The result is increased ATP synthesis, the energy that fuels cell proliferation and regeneration — the same principle, on a cellular scale, that underlies photosynthesis in plants.
Light is a form of energy — photonic energy — measurable as a flow of photons. Wavelength, expressed in nanometers, determines its interaction with the skin: the visible spectrum used in LED phototherapy ranges from 400nm (violet) to 700nm (red). Unlike IPL and lasers, the power levels used in LED therapy carry no risk to skin or tissue.
Wavelength and frequency are inversely proportional: the shorter the wavelength, the higher the frequency and the energy it carries. Below 400nm lie ultraviolet rays, X-rays and gamma rays, all high-energy; above 700nm lie infrared, radio waves and microwaves, at lower energy. Visible light — between 400 and 700nm — is the portion used by LED phototherapy.

The visible spectrum ranges from 400nm (violet) to 700nm (red): each wavelength interacts differently with the skin.
Known as "biologically active light": reaches the dermis and stimulates fibroblasts, increasing collagen and elastin production, neoangiogenesis and mitochondrial ATP. Suitable for all skin types, also indicated on the periocular area and forehead to reduce fine lines and wrinkles; useful for relieving muscle pain and speeding recovery after trauma.
A genuine antibacterial agent against acne-causing bacteria (propionibacteria): reduces comedones and inflammation, regulates excess sebum on oily skin without damaging tissue. Penetrates up to 0.5mm and helps delay and counter skin sagging.
Indicated for combination skin: improves dermal cell function, increases oxygen production and activates surface microcirculation. Anti-wrinkle and calming action, reduces redness and rosacea, lightens pigmentation, freckles and sun-damage spots.
A combination of red and blue: strengthens skin protein fibers, improves complexion, reduces pore dilation, swelling, edema and wrinkle depth. Relaxing action on the skin, boosts blood circulation.
A combination of blue and green: gradually increases cell energy, promotes skin metabolism and regulates glandular function. Activates collagen and protein synthesis, brightens complexion, mitigates inflammation and promotes relaxation of tense skin.
Classified in medical terms as amber light: reduces redness, soothes sensitive or inflamed skin, improves microcirculation. Very effective on rosacea and spider veins, fades dark spots, freckles and UV damage.
A simultaneous mix of all frequencies: a relaxing effect that activates the skin's natural renewal system, countering signs of aging and restoring a younger, healthier look. Used to open and close every chromo-photonic sequence.
A complete session, from skin preparation to maintaining results over time.
Before each session, skincare products, creams and makeup are completely removed so the emitted light is fully absorbed by the skin.
The helmet is placed on the client's head with the front reflector oriented toward the face; the operator selects the most suitable protocol among the 10 available.
Each treatment lasts about 30–50 minutes, depending on the protocol chosen and the client's goal.
Depending on the goal, collagen creams or acne-specific creams are applied, to improve skin quality and treat problem areas.
First results are visible immediately and persist for the following 48 hours; full results of each cycle last from 6 to 12 months.
To preserve results over time, monthly and/or quarterly follow-ups are recommended, combined with cosmetological and cosmeceutical guidance for home use.
